## Platform-agnostic design
|
||||
|
||||
Skills must NEVER hardcode framework-specific commands, file patterns, or directory
|
||||
structures. Instead:
|
||||
|
||||
1. **Read CLAUDE.md** for project-specific config (test commands, eval commands, etc.)
|
||||
2. **If missing, AskUserQuestion** — let the user tell you or let gstack search the repo
|
||||
3. **Persist the answer to CLAUDE.md** so we never have to ask again
|
||||
|
||||
This applies to test commands, eval commands, deploy commands, and any other
|
||||
project-specific behavior. The project owns its config; gstack reads it.
